Tips for Buying Health Care Businesses In Tarrant County, TX

Understand the Regulatory Environment

When considering the purchase of a health care business in Tarrant County, TX, it is crucial to familiarize yourself with both state and federal regulations that govern medical practices, clinics, and other healthcare enterprises. Texas has specific licensing requirements for healthcare professionals and business operations, including compliance with HIPAA and Texas Medical Board guidelines. Additionally, local ordinances may affect your operation. Engage legal and compliance experts early in the process to conduct thorough due diligence, ensuring all current licenses are valid and the business has a clean regulatory history.

Analyze Market Demand and Competition

The health care sector in Tarrant County is diverse, with numerous hospitals, clinics, and specialty practices serving a rapidly growing population. Conduct a detailed market analysis to understand demand for specific services—such as primary care, elder care, or specialized therapies—in your target location. Use demographic data and local health statistics to gauge future growth prospects. Also, evaluate your prospective competitors and identify opportunities for differentiation, whether through unique services, partnerships, or superior patient care.

Assess Financial Health and Operational Efficiency

Review the financial records of any potential acquisition with a critical eye. Look beyond revenue, scrutinizing profit margins, accounts receivable, and patient churn rates. Confirm that the business has solid billing practices and minimal outstanding insurance claims. Assess staff qualifications, retention rates, and workflow efficiency, as employee expertise and patient satisfaction are vital to ongoing success. Ask for at least three years of financial statements, tax returns, and patient volume history to get a clear picture of both risks and opportunities before making an offer.
